Biography
Christine Kirkpatrick leads the San Diego Supercomputer Center’s Research Data Services division, which manages large-scale infrastructure, networking, and services for research projects of regional and national scope. Her research is in data-centric AI, working at the intersection of ML and FAIR, with a focus on making AI more efficient to save on power consumption and 'time to science'. Kirkpatrick serves as PI of the FAIR in ML, AI Readiness & Reproducibility RCN which focuses on promoting better practices for AI, improving reproducibility, and exploring research gaps in data-centric AI. In addition, Kirkpatrick founded the GO FAIR US Office and is on the Executive Committee for the Open Storage Network. Christine serves as a member of The National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ine on their Board on Research Data and Information (BRDI). She serves as the Secretary General of CODATA.
